Q.1. For hypoeutoctoid plain carbon steel (select %C content yourself), determine the phases that are present, the compositions of these phases, and the percentages or fractions of the phases. Make schematic sketches of the microstructure that would be observed for conditions of very slow cooling at the following temperatures: a) Just above the austenite transformation temperature b) The austenite transformation temperature - 10°C c) The eutectoid transformation temperature +10°C d) The eutectoid transformation temperature - 10°C
